Medical Education Training Program — Foot and Ankle

FOOT AND ANKLE TRAUMA COURSE LEVEL III

Saturday, February 2, 2019
San Diego, CA

 

DESCRIPTION

This technique-oriented program is designed to expose physician attendees to the latest surgical concepts in foot and ankle surgical techniques. Practical hands-on lab and training sessions maximize surgeon exposure to the latest tools and techniques.

AGENDA

Saturday, February 2, 2019

7:15 am Breakfast
7:30 am Opening Comments
  Didactic Session I: Syndesmosis Controversies
8:00 am Syndesmosis TightRope® Implant Outcomes: Where Are We Now?
8:10 am AITFL Repair With InternalBrace Ligament Augmentation
8:20 am Deltoid Repair in the Acutely Injured Ankle
8:30 am Case Presentations: Syndesmosis Controversies
  Didactic Session II: Ankle and Pilon Fracture
8:50 am Minimally Invasive Fibula Fixation
9:00 am Posterior Malleolus Fractures in the 21st Century: Modern Indications for Fixation
9:10 am Is 6 Weeks Too Long? Status of Weight-Bearing Recommendations After Ankle ORIF
9:20 am Approach Planning for Pilon Fractures
9:30 am Case Presentations: Challenges in Ankle and Pilon Management
10:00 am Break
Didactic Session III: Ankle Osteochondral Defects
10:10 am Ankle Arthroscopy in the Fractured Ankle
10:20 am Management of Traumatic Talar OCD
Didactic IV: Midfoot/Forefoot Trauma
10:30 am 5th Metatarsal Base Nonunion
10:40 am Surgical Solutions for Lisfranc Fracture/Dislocation
10:50 am Case Presentations: Midfoot/Forefoot Fracture Case Presentations
Didactic V: Calcaneus Fracture
11:20 am Extensile vs Sinus Tarsi for Calcaneal Fractures
11:30 am Case Presentations: Fuse or Fix? Severe Fractures of the Calcaneus
12:00 pm Lunch
12:45 pm Cadaveric Session
4:00 pm Adjourn
